INTRODUCTION

There is much confusion about the timing of the so-called “Gog and Magog War” of Ezekiel 38 and 39, which involves various nations attacking Israel from the north, nearby, and from northeast Africa.

Probably the most-oft proclaimed explanations are that this war could happen anytime now – before, or else during, the tribulation.

This study contends that a careful reading of the context of Ezekiel 34 through 39 (and even looking at chapters 40 and thereafter) proves the title of this post to be true.

The reader is first urged, and helped, to remember what happened to that special kingdom God built under David and then Solomon, starting with Solomon’s son, King Rehoboam.

And secondly, it is most helpful to understand more about how Israel was declared by the United Nations in 1948 to be a sovereign nation.

WHAT IS MEANT BY “ALL THE HOUSE OF ISRAEL”?

Most in the USA and other nations today tend to think of the Jews when “Israel” is mentioned.

Yes, the Jews are Israelites – but they are NOT THE ONLY ISRAELITES!

Remember that Abraham begat Isaac, who begat Jacob. And God later changed Jacob’s name to “Israel”. Over time, Israel had one daughter and twelve sons – of whom Judah was one. From Genesis onward the “Old Testament” primarily traces the history of the tribes of Israel, and the nations with whom Israel had to do.

David, a Jew (and a man after God’s own heart – Acts 13:22) was chosen by God to be the second king in Israel, after Saul had failed. The Jews were rightly pleased to have David as their king, but the other tribes of Israel protested that THEY also were very much behind David – and he truly became the beloved king of ALL the tribes of Israel!

Solomon, a son of David, was the next king, and God used him to make Israel a beautiful, blessed kingdom that had the admiration of all other nations who knew about him and Israel! But Solomon turned from God. And his son Rehoboam, who became the next king decided (foolishly and against the advice of his oldest and wisest counselors) to put heavy taxes upon the people. So the “northern tribes” in the land, who were not Jews, decided to follow Jeroboam and rebel (as see 1Kings 12:16). Thus most of the non-Jews in Israel broke away, under Jeroboam, and had their own kings over the next few hundred years. And NONE of those Northern Kingdom kings was righteous before God, nor most of their people, so they went into captivity under the Assyrians for their sinful disobedience.

The Southern Kingdom also had a line of kings after Rehoboam. They (the Jews, but also some non-Jewish Israelites, including from Benjamin and Levi) tended to be more righteous, at least at first, and had several good kings and periods of “revival”. Eventually, their sins also became so heavy that God finally used Nebuchadnezzar of Babylon to destroy the temple in Jerusalem and, over time, carry most of the Jews into captivity.

Starting 70 years later, the Jews returned to Jerusalem and surrounding areas, in the time of Ezra and Nehemiah. They had their problems but were in the land for Jesus the Christ to be born and live there, and thus the “New Testament” Church began in that famous Day of Pentecost in Jerusalem.

The Northern Kingdom (which the Bible often refers to as “the house of Israel” and later the Southern Kingdom (originally known as “the house of David”, and later – after the split into two kingdoms – often referred to as “the house of Judah”), were taken into captivity by the will and working of God through rulers of gentile nations, because of their sins..

Jews had been found in many nations all around the world, well before and long after some of them went into, and later returned, from captivity to Jerusalem in the time of Ezra and Nehemiah.

There was no such return to their land of the tribes who composed the Northern Kingdom before Assyria carried them captive. What happened to them is not commonly known today, but the knowledge does exist. Of course God knew what would happen, and He knew all along that there would come a time (yet future even today!) that they would be reunited as ONE kingdom. (See verses above in Ezekiel 34 and 36, and also, for example, Jeremiah 3:18 and Isaiah 11:11-15.)
